Flame Retardant Mining Fiber Cable Miners Application Outdoor 4 Core Glass Fiber Optic Cable
Features:
1.Good flame retardant performance.
2.High strength loose tube that is hydrolysis resistant.
3.Double sheathes and single armor providing excellent crush resistance, water proof, and avoiding rat bite.
4.Loose tube wrapped by non-weaven tape has the water blocking ability.
5.Special tube filling compound ensure a critical protection of fiber.
6.Blue PVC jacket: Flame retardant, the blue color is easy to identify.
7.Crush resistance and flexibility.
Application:
1.Professional usage for the coal industry
2.Tunnel shaft
3.Mine
